Approvals and Regional Requirements in Sammamish

Construction Permit Necessities

Securing the correct building permit is essential for any pergola construction in Sammamish. The city follows strict municipal development standards, especially for structures over 120 square feet or those with electrical work. A certified landscape architect can manage the approval process efficiently.

  • Submit detailed site plans to the city planning department
  • Detail measurements, material types, and utility connections
  • Coordinate a project consultation to prevent delays

Budget and Construction Duration

Budget Expectations for Backyard Remodeling

Mid-range landscape upgrades in Sammamish typically range from 15k–50k, depending on scope. A basic concrete pavers patio may cost budget-friendly, while full-scale projects with covered patio and decking reach six figures. Getting a cost breakdown from a licensed hardscape contractor helps set realistic expectations.

  • Entry-level designs with native plants landscaping start around mid-teens
  • Mid-tier builds with cedar decking average 30k–50k
  • Luxury transformations exceed 60k
